Also, the facility will give you other relapse prevention methods to ensure that you stay clean
and sober after the rehab is done. For instance,
they may be able to help you to gain new occupational skills, better
learn how to manage your money and take care of your finances, teach you
how to preform well at job interviews, and help you to develop
better habits regarding hygiene, cleanliness, and physical appearance.
Since substance abuse affects all areas of your
life, it is crucial that you work on every aspect related
to your addiction - in addition to your physical dependence
on drugs.
While working to make sure that addiction no longer has any significance in your life,
therefore, long-term drug
and alcohol rehab centers in Jetmore, Kansas also focus on the mental attributes of addiction. This is why these
programs provide various types of counseling
and treatment.
The length of the rehab program will vary for each client depending on several
factors. Some of these factors are, the severity and duration
of your addiction, the kinds of substances abused, as well as the presence
of a dual diagnosis or a co-occurring mental health condition arising from or exacerbated by your drug use.
